    It is for the competent authorities to take an informed call on matters of regulation of public transport, Court said.

    The Delhi High Court on Tuesday dismissed a plea challenging the decision of Delhi Government to permit 100% seating capacity in Metro as well as DTC and cluster buses plying in the national capital amid Covid-19 pandemic.
